HANDOVER — Commission Scheme Revision

To the incoming director: the revised scheme goes live on the 1st. Key changes: accelerators start at 110% of quota, not 100%; multi-year Quillstone deals pay out over term, not upfront; clawbacks extend to nine months. Reps were briefed last week — expect pushback from the Ashgrove pod. Payroll mapping is done; Tomas owns the calculator. Disputes route through RevOps, not you. One outstanding item: the enterprise override rate is unresolved. Background for that decision sits below.

internal memo for kahif-kawig: Project Fravan slips by two quarters because of the tooling delay.

**Vendor note: Inkmill markdown pipeline**

Rendering for Parchway docs is outsourced to Inkmill under an annual contract, renewing each March. They handle sanitization and PDF export; we own the upload queue. SLA: 4-hour response on rendering failures. Escalate only after two failed retries. Their support desk is reachable at the address below.

billing contact of hahaf-baguf = zorael.tammir.jorius@sivrelhq.internal

**Ticket #4182 — DeployBot vault locked, again**

Hey, quick one for whoever reviews this: the Quillhatch vault holding DeployBot's status-webhook creds locked itself after three failed unseal attempts during last night's rotation. The bot is now silently dropping deploy-status messages in the #ship-it channel, so folks think builds are stuck. Fix is merged; we just need to unseal. Per runbook, the recovery passphrase for the vault is as follows.

unlock words, hahip-yagef: zorok-novmir-zorix-silax

Quarterly Planning Note – Insurance Renewal

The Fenbright Manufacturing combined policy renews at quarter-end. Broker quotes show a 9% premium increase; property and liability terms unchanged. Heads of department must confirm asset registers within two weeks. Cyber cover extension under evaluation. The confidential note on related business plans is set out below.

board note of kagep-yahig: Only 9 of the 120 pilot accounts renewed Quenix, so a churn review is set for April 1.